HR Director Jobs in Lancaster, PA

A HR Director, or Human Resources Director, plays a pivotal role in developing and implementing policies and strategies related to all aspects of human resources management. This includes talent acquisition, learning and development, employee relations, compensation and benefits, and compliance with labor laws. As leaders, they guide and manage the overall provision of Human Resources services and programs for an entire organization. They collaborate with top management in decision-making and act as a bridge between the management and employees, ensuring a positive work environment and employee satisfaction.

Some of the key skills required for an HR Director role include leadership, strategic thinking, excellent communication, and interpersonal skills. Additionally, a thorough understanding of labor laws, personal management, and employee relations is crucial. They are usually expected to hold a bachelor's degree in human resources, business, or a related field, with many employers preferring a master's degree. Certifications like Professional in Human Resources (PHR), Senior Professional in Human Resources (SPHR), or Society for Human Resource Management Certified Professional (SHRM-CP) can significantly enhance their credentials. Typically, before becoming a HR Director, a professional could hold roles such as HR Generalist, HR Manager, or HR Business Partner.

The Changing Face of HR Certification

The Society for Human Resource Management (SHRM) recently announced that it would begin offering its own version of professional certifications beginning in 2015, thereby ending its more than 40-year relationship with the HR Certification Institute (HRCI), an organization SHRM created specifically to administer certification examinations.
